Centennial Surgical Suture Ltd has filed an initial disclosure with BSE confirming that it does not qualify as a 'Large Corporate' under SEBI's framework for debt securities issuance. The company cited SEBI Circular No. SEBI/HO/DDHS/CIR/P/2018/144 dated November 26, 2018, as the reference framework. In the disclosure form (Annexure A), the company left fields for outstanding borrowing and credit rating as 'Not Applicable' since the Large Corporate classification does not apply to it. The filing was signed by Mahima Bathwal, Company Secretary and Compliance Officer, and submitted on April 29, 2026.
